Vino and Spot

Spot is this cat from the neighbourhood that always comes around. She is white with a brown tail that is half length and has a ball on the end. She also has brown ears and a perfect brown circle on her right side. We think that she belongs to one of the neighbours but is an outdoor cat. She is skinny but not scrawny.

Anyway, Spot and Vino have a love-hate relationship with each other. They love to hate each other! Spot comes to the window almost every day and Vino gets super excited and agitated. He'll crouch in front of the window and stare at her. She is a brazen hussy who will rub up against the BBQ, shoe rack, patio furniture, etc. She also lolls about on the welcome mat, stretching and exposing her belly. This drives Vino insane because all that out there is *his* territory if his mean slaves would only let him go out! Sometimes, if Vino doesn't seem mad enough, Spot will jump at the window and hiss at Vino. Vino will jolt a bit but mostly just continues to crouch where he is.

Yesterday, I had just given Vino his dinner, when Spot arrived. Vino was unsure as to what to do. Eat his dinner or have a showdown with Spot? He ate a few bites. He ran to the screen door and glared a Spot. He ran back to his food and ate a few bites. It was all too much excitement and he barfed up all his food. Poor Vino.

Dennis picked Vino up and held him there so he could look down upon his nemesis. I thought Vino would be resentful and embarrassed at being held like a baby by his daddy. Interestingly, Vino loved it. He got all perky eared and looked soooooo smug. Soon Spot got the message and left while spewing a barrage of nasty cuss words at us and Vino. Bye Spot!

Vino got a 2nd dinner which he ate in peace and managed to keep down.
